The Queensland Bloodstream Infections (QBSI) study: rationale, protocol development and future directions
Kevin B Laupland1,2, Felicity Edwards1, Patrick N A Harris3,4
1School of Medicine, Queensland University of Technology (QUT), Brisbane, Australia.
This study outlines the Queensland Bloodstream Infection (BSI) surveillance program, establishing a framework to investigate BSI epidemiology and outcomes. The findings aim to reduce the global burden of bloodstream infections through enhanced data collection and analysis.

Background:
- High-quality bloodstream infection (BSI) surveillance data is crucial for effective control strategies.
- Population-based investigations into BSIs are currently limited globally.
- The Queensland BSI (QBSI) study addresses this gap by establishing comprehensive surveillance.
Purpose of the Study:
- To detail the rationale behind the Queensland BSI (QBSI) study.
- To describe the protocol development for this large-scale BSI surveillance program.
- To provide a model for other regions to develop similar BSI epidemiology studies.
Main Methods:
- Population-based laboratory surveillance of all BSIs in Queensland's public healthcare system (2000-2023).
- Linkage with hospital admissions and vital statistics for 1-year post-BSI outcomes.
- Standardized definitions for BSI episodes and classification by onset type.
Main Results:
- Over 3.7 million blood cultures processed, identifying 444,279 positive cultures.
- Extensive linkage data (2.4M+ hospital registrations, 10M+ ICD codes) analyzed.
- Comorbidities classified using ICD-based algorithms; 30, 90, and 365-day all-cause case-fatality assessed.
Conclusions:
- The QBSI study provides a robust framework for examining BSI epidemiology and outcomes in a large Australian population.
- Sharing experiences from the QBSI study aims to foster international collaboration.
- The ultimate goal is to accelerate BSI knowledge globally and reduce the disease burden.
